Definition

Logos is a Greek word meaning 'word', 'speech', 'reason', or 'thought'.

Usage note

Primarily used in philosophy and theology to refer to the principle of reason or the divine word. Less commonly used in everyday English, where 'reason' or 'logic' are preferred.
